VLADISLAV GORANOV: LOWER THAN THE PLANNED IN THE REVISION DEFICIT WOULD LEAD TO ACCUMULATION OF HUGE ARREARS TO THE BUSINESSES

11.11.2014

 

We do not want to transfer to the next year the failures of the wrongly drafted budget

 "The Council of Ministers has approved and will propose to the National Assembly a Law to amend the Value Added Tax Law with amendments provided therein to amend the other tax laws and a Law to amend the 2014 State Budget of Republic of Bulgaria Law", Minister Vladislav Goranov stated at a press conference after the ad hoc meeting of the Government. When presenting the draft VATL in its part on the excise duties and tax warehouses Minister Goranov specified that a 3-step schedule was provided for raising excise on tobacco to reach the minimum EU rate of EUR 90 per 1,000 pcs. until 2018. He emphasised that the decision the first step to be implemented as from 1 January 2016 was determined by the increasing contraband. "We will make considerable efforts to improve the joint work of the revenue administrations to reduce it. We do not consider proper to make this change in the excise duty on tobacco before we are convinced that we have harnessed the processes and reduced the drastically increased in the last year and half contraband", Minister Goranov commented.

The Minister of Finance explained also the draft to revise the this year budget, which was based on a precise analysis of the expenditure side. He assured that urgent expenditures were included, which if not paid would become arrears for 2015. "The deficit is high, but objective," he pointed out in reply to a question how would he reply to the criticisms for its rising to 3.7% of GDP. "This is a quite high deficit being the result of wrong planning and bad European Funds management", he added.  The Finance Minister was adamant that lower than the planned deficit would lead to accumulation of huge arrears to the businesses and its carrying over to the next year, which on its part would distort the actual results for its value. According to the Minister we will show lower deficit on a cash basis, which the EC will immediately adjust with the real expenditure on accrual basis that the state should have made. "We have no fault for the thus wrongly drafted budget and we do not want to transfer the failures thereof to the next year", is his position. He added: "We are aware that an excessive deficit procedure could be initiated against Bulgaria. We will explain to our colleagues in Brussels what has caused it and we will take the necessary steps as soon as possible to bring the national public finances within the 3% deficit limit."

Vladislav Goranov pointed out that in the transitional and final provisions of the draft to amend the budget texts had been included related to the solution of the problems caused by the revocation of the CCB licence. "The Bank Deposit Insurance Fund is only a tool of the state to honour its commitments to the Bulgarian citizens and the attempts to transfer the subject to it is evading responsibility - the state must do its work and ensure the payment of these deposits as soon as possible", Minister of Finance Vladislav Goranov stated.
